Use a Channel when people should reach a supported Cloud Agent from an external chat. Connecting a bot, linking it to an Agent, and pairing a chat are three separate relationships.

Before you begin

  • Have a Running Cloud Agent.
  • In the dashboard, confirm that Library > Channels shows the messaging provider you want to use.
  • Choose a Clawdi bot, or prepare your own bot credentials for a custom connection.

Steps

1

Choose a bot

Open Library > Channels in the Clawdi dashboard. Choose a bot under Clawdi bots. To use your own, choose Add channel and complete the requested setup; it appears under Custom bots. For a custom WhatsApp account, use a dedicated number.
2

Link it to the Agent

Open the Cloud Agent’s Channels, choose the bot, and select Link. The bot row now offers Pair and Unlink.Agent Channels with Clawdi Telegram linked, zero paired chats, and Pair and Unlink actions.The bot is linked. Pair your chosen chat next. View full-size image
3

Pair one chat

Choose Pair and follow the current QR code, link, command, or code shown by the dashboard. If a pairing code expires, generate a new one instead of reusing it.
4

Send a test message

Send a harmless message from the paired chat. Confirm that the chat appears beneath the linked Channel and review Activity and Health on the Channel page.
The bot is linked to the intended Cloud Agent, the external chat is paired, and a test message appears in Channel activity without an error.
Bot tokens are secrets. Enter them only in the dashboard credential field; never place them in a Memory, prompt, screenshot, or committed file.
